Is America headed toward renewal—or decline?
As the United States approaches its 250th anniversary, the stakes could not be higher.
In this powerful episode of the City of God, Dr. Rob Pacienza sits down with author, historian, and cultural commentator Os Guinness to examine the future of the American experiment… and what it will take to preserve it.
Drawing from his latest work on America’s founding and future, Guinness argues that while free societies are rare in history, lasting free societies are even rarer. America now stands at a pivotal crossroads.
From the rise of global authoritarianism to the erosion of biblical principles at home, this conversation challenges listeners to rethink what truly made America great in the first place and whether those foundations can be recovered.
You’ll hear about:
- Why America’s 250th anniversary is a defining moment in world history
● What made America unique and why those principles have been largely forgotten
● The growing global threat of authoritarianism and why freedom is at risk
● The difference between the American Revolution (1776) and the French Revolution (1789)
● Why freedom, if misunderstood, can ultimately destroy itself
● The urgent need for a national “homecoming” back to truth, faith, and first principles
Guinness makes a compelling case that America’s strength cannot be measured by military or economic power alone, but by a spirit of freedom rooted in faith.
As the nation looks ahead to July 4, 2026, this episode calls Christians to move beyond outrage and rediscover their role as guardians of truth, freedom, and moral clarity.
